This article investigates Semalt, a service that appears as fake referral traffic in Google Analytics. It explains that Semalt is a Ukrainian analytics/SEO company whose crawler simulates user behavior, skewing website stats. The author notes security concerns (McAfee flags it as malware) and provides methods to filter Semalt out of Analytics or block it via .htaccess.
